WHAT DO THE COVID-19 & ANTIBODY TESTS DETECT?

Rapid COVID-19 (Antigen) Test:

This test will detect if you are actively infected with the COVID -19 virus by detecting a protein that is part of the virus.

PCR Test: 

A PCR (Polymerase Chain Reaction) test likewise detects if you are actively infected with the COVID-19 virus, by searching for the virus’s genetic material on a molecular level.

Antibody Test:

This test will detect if you have had prior exposure to or infection with COVID-19 and have developed antibodies for the virus. For most viral illnesses, a positive antibody means prior exposure to a virus and possible immunity to future infection. As COVID-19 is a new infection, it is unclear if a positive antibody offers immunity. Madison Rapid recommends universal precautions (Hand washing, social distancing and masks when appropriate).

HOW ARE THE TESTS ADMINISTERED?

COVID-19 (Antigen) and PCR Test:

The antigen test is administered via lower nasal swab, and the PCR test is administered via an upper nasal swab. 

 

Antibody Test:
Test is administered via finger prick blood sample.

WHAT IS THE DIFFERENCE BETWEEN AN ANTIGEN TEST AND A PCR TEST?

Both tests are administered via a nasal swab, with the antigen test being a lower nasal swab, and the PCR test being an upper nasal swab.  The antigen test detects a protein that is part of the coronavirus.  Whereas the PCR (Polymerase Chain Reaction) tests detects the coronavirus’ genetic material on a molecular level.  Antigen tests results are faster, and usually available within 30 minutes. PCR tests are more accurate, but results can take a few days to process.
